Verifying a localized unidirectional-flow zone, not a whole room
A laminar air flow (LAF) unit is a bench or workstation, horizontal or vertical, that pushes filtered air across its work zone in a single, unidirectional pattern. It is a localized clean-air zone rather than a whole controlled room — the distinction that separates LAF testing from clean room testing, even though both are concerned with contamination control. LAF units are commonly used for pharmaceutical dispensing, sterile compounding and other clean handling work.
LAF testing focuses on whether that unidirectional flow is actually being achieved: consistent airflow velocity, uniform distribution across the work area, and a HEPA filter that is holding its integrity. This is also functionally distinct from a biosafety cabinet — an LAF unit is built to protect the product or process from contamination, while a biosafety cabinet is also designed to protect the operator, typically through a contained airflow design.

Parameters covered in laminar air flow testing
- Airflow velocity across the work zone
- Uniformity and pattern of the unidirectional flow
- HEPA filter integrity feeding the LAF unit
- Particle count within the work zone
